How do scientists organize the major events of Earth's history?

Biology
1 answer:
erik [133]3 years ago
7 0

Answer: They divide it on eons.

Explanation:

They can see it from geologic strata and the fossil record. Major volcanic events altering the Earth's environment and causing extinctions may have occurred 10 times in the past 3 billion years. Different eons have different animal and plant life. (eg. trilobites)
